Horizon Europe: New Calls Cluster 2 for the period 2026-2027

Wednesday 26 November 2025, 11:18

The European Commission has published draft work programs on its Comitology Register website. The work program for Cluster 2 – Culture, Creativity, and Inclusive Society can be downloaded from the Work Program 2026-2027 part 5. Culture, Creativity, and Inclusive Society - version 2 of July 7, 2025

This is a draft work program for the 2026–2027 period, but no major changes are expected. The European Commission will hold an information day on the new Cluster 2 calls on March 26, 2026. The program and a link to watch it will be published here. Following the information day, an online partner exchange will take place on the Horizon Europe Cluster 2 Community Platform website. Registration is now open.

The Technology Center Prague is organizing its national information day on January 20, 2026.


Cluster 2 focuses on social sciences and humanities, cultural heritage, and cultural and creative industries. Projects submitted to this cluster deal with research into democratic governance and citizen participation in democracy, explore ways of protecting cultural heritage and the role of cultural and creative industries, and analyze social and economic transformation.


Expected date of official publication of the work program: end of 2025
TA ČR National Information Day on new Cluster 2 calls: January 20, 2026
Deadline for project submission: September 23, 2026
